Q:   What are the subjects taught in BA?
A: 

The core subjects are usually the same. Though the electives differ. Some of the major ones taught are - English, History, Psychology, Political Science, Philosophy, Social work, Economics, Sociology, Anthropology, Rural Studies, and more. Bachelor of Arts is a 3 year program. It can be pursued full-time, part-time, or through distance learning.

Q:   What are the minor subjects included in the GITAM BA History course?
A: 

GITAM SOT BA syllabus includes a semester-wise list of subjects. The syllabus comprises various major and minor subjects. GITAM allows its BA students to choose minors that align with their interests. This allows students to choose the subjects that align with their career paths. Some of the minor subjects included in the first year of BA are Understanding Psychological Disturbances, Lifespan Development, History of Medieval India, the Indian National Movement, Science and Technology in India-A Historical Perspective, and more.
